The University of Tennessee at Chattanooga (UT Chattanooga) is a medium‑sized public university in downtown Chattanooga, Tennessee, known for its urban‑integrated campus, strong focus on experiential learning, and close‑knit “Mocs” community. Students often rave about the walkable downtown location, the many campus events, the friendly small‑class feel, and the easy access to internships, outdoor recreation, and the Tennessee River scene.

Men's Team Notes

Mocs men posted historic 286.84 team average over 37 rounds with record 266 low round at Scenic City Invite. Multiple top finishes showcased depth; strong par-or-better consistency across invitationals fueled national contention on challenging Tennessee layouts amid windy conditions.

Women's Team Notes

Mocs women achieved 292.5 adjusted average over 9 rounds ranked #80 nationally with 1 top-3 finish. Fernandez-Tagle's 72 final round anchored runner-up at SoCon Championships; balanced scoring propelled postseason positioning on Southern tracks.
